Data Engineer II

Cincinnati, OH, United States

ConstructConnect

See why the largest construction contractors trust ConstructConnect to grow their construction business. Access full bidders lists, details, and plans & specs.

View all jobs at ConstructConnect

Apply now Apply later

Overview

This position sits within our Product Development division, which develops, tests, and improves our software solutions in an innovative and collaborative environment. 

 

ConstructConnect has built up multiple sources of data over the course of many years and acquisitions. Our data engineers work to build bridges and pathways between data sources. Our goal of one source of truth is accomplished with a myriad of tools as we build out the company’s data lake and data warehouse. This role has the unique opportunity to consume and manage the nation’s largest collection of construction data.

 

The ideal candidate for this role is excited about data in all its forms, desires to build a source of data truth, and is looking forward to leveraging Google Cloud’s vast array of data technologies.

The Data Engineer Level II enhances and builds our data pipelines using a combination of advanced technologies and standard engineering practices. They are responsible for working with the software engineering, marketing, product, data science, and customer service teams to ensure our data is delivered in a timely and scalable fashion.

Responsibilities

  • Assembling large, complex sets of data that meet business requirements
  • Modernizing and innovating data delivery pipelines using cloud technologies
  • Ensuring data is properly curated and transformed for analysis and consumption
  • Collaborating with data scientists and architects
  • Lead code reviews and mentor junior team members, fostering best practices in data engineering
  • Implementing best practices for data governance and security
  • Optimizing data workflows and performance tuning
  • Identify and resolve complex data pipeline issues independently
  • Apply software engineering principles (version control, CI/CD, testing) to maintain a scalable data ecosystem
  • This job description in no way implies that the duties listed here are the only ones that team members can be required to perform

Qualifications

  • Bachelor’s Degree or equivalent experience in Computer Sciences, Database Development, or a related discipline
  • 3-5 years of experience in directly related positions
  • Creative problem-solver who is passionate about digging into complex problems and devising new approaches to reach results
  • Strong communication skills and experience distilling and presenting complex quantitative analysis into action-oriented recommendations
  • Advanced understanding of programming languages such as Python, JavaScript, C#, or other language
  • Advanced understanding of SQL Queries, Stored Procedures, Views, and Triggers
  • Advanced understanding of the concepts of ETL or ELT (Extract, Transform, Load) processes
  • Familiarity with cloud-based data technologies (GCP preferred)
  • Handles sensitive and confidential data/information
  • The physical activities of this position include frequent sitting, telephone communication, working on a computer for extended periods of time. Visual acuity is required to perform activities close to the eyes. 
  • This position is a hybrid position and team members are expected to have a dedicated and established remote workspace.   
  • Ability to work hybrid in the Greater Cincinnati/Northern Kentucky Area. 

Physical Demands and Work Environment 

  

  • The physical activities of this position include frequent sitting, telephone communication, working on a computer for extended periods of time. Visual acuity is required to perform activities close to the eyes. 
  • This position is a hybrid position and team members are expected to have a dedicated and established remote workspace.   
  • Ability to work hybrid in the Greater Cincinnati/Northern Kentucky Area. 

 

E-Verify StatementConstructConnect utilizes the E-Verify program with every potential new hire. This makes it possible for us to make certain that every employee who works for ConstructConnect is eligible to work in the United States. To learn more about E-Verify you can call 1-800-255-7688 or visit their website. E-Verify® is a registered trademark of the United States Department of Homeland Security.

Privacy Notice

Apply now Apply later

* Salary range is an estimate based on our AI, ML, Data Science Salary Index 💰

Job stats:  0  0  0
Category: Engineering Jobs

Tags: CI/CD Data governance Data pipelines Data warehouse ELT Engineering ETL GCP Google Cloud JavaScript Pipelines Privacy Python Security SQL Testing

Region: North America
Country: United States

More jobs like this